Vail Christian came into Saturday's contest looking for another win against Denver Christian, but Hadley Pellegrino wouldn't allow it. The Thunder walked away with a 3-1 victory over the Saints on Saturday with plenty of help from Pellegrino, who had 20 assists and six digs. She is on a roll when it comes to assists, as she's now posted 12 or more in each of the last four games she's played.
The match finished with set scores of 25-17, 27-25, 21-25, 25-23.
Despite the loss, Vail Christian still got an impressive performance from Sam Bates, who had 17 digs and one assist.

The win was the third in a row for Denver Christian, bringing their record up to 13-4. As for Vail Christian, their defeat ended a nine-match streak of wins at home dating back to last season and dropped them to 13-3.
Denver Christian has already played their next match, a 3-0 victory against St. Mary's Academy on the 7th. As for Vail Christian, they also did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next matchup, a 3-0 win against De Beque on the 7th.
